Bonus Features

Random Multipliers

One of the most exciting features in Rise of Maya is the Random Multiplier mechanic that activates during the Free Spins bonus round. When this feature triggers, a randomly selected multiplier is applied to all wins during that particular free spin. These multipliers can range from 2x up to an impressive 10x, dramatically increasing the payout potential of any winning combination.

The Random Multiplier adds an element of unpredictability and excitement to the Free Spins feature, as players never know when a high multiplier might combine with a significant win for a massive payout. This feature is central to achieving the game's maximum win potential of 1,120x stake and keeps the bonus rounds thrilling from start to finish.

Free Spins Feature

The Free Spins feature is the main bonus attraction in Rise of Maya and is triggered by landing three or more Scatter symbols anywhere on the reels. The number of free spins awarded follows this structure:

  • 3 Scatter symbols: 10 Free Spins
  • 4 Scatter symbols: 15 Free Spins
  • 5 Scatter symbols: 20 Free Spins

During Free Spins, the game's atmosphere intensifies, and all the special features come into play simultaneously. The Random Multipliers are active throughout the bonus round, and Stacked Wilds appear more frequently, creating the perfect conditions for substantial wins. The Free Spins play out automatically, though players can use speed options to accelerate the action if preferred.

Stacked Wilds

The Stacked Wilds feature is another key component of Rise of Maya's bonus mechanics. Wild symbols can appear stacked on the reels, potentially covering entire reel columns with Wild symbols. When multiple stacked Wilds appear simultaneously, they can create multiple winning combinations across numerous paylines.

During the Free Spins feature, Stacked Wilds become even more valuable due to the Random Multiplier mechanic. A full stack of Wilds combined with a high multiplier can result in some of the game's most impressive payouts. The visual effect of Stacked Wilds is particularly satisfying, with the ancient stone Wilds cascading down the reels in dramatic fashion.

Re-triggers

The Free Spins feature in Rise of Maya includes a re-trigger mechanism that can significantly extend the bonus round. If additional Scatter symbols land during the Free Spins, extra spins are added to the remaining count. The re-trigger follows the same award structure as the initial trigger:

  • 3 Scatters during Free Spins: +10 additional Free Spins
  • 4 Scatters during Free Spins: +15 additional Free Spins
  • 5 Scatters during Free Spins: +20 additional Free Spins

Multiple re-triggers are possible within a single bonus round, though there is typically a maximum cap on the total number of Free Spins that can be accumulated. This re-trigger potential adds significant value to the bonus feature and creates opportunities for extended winning sessions.

RTP Analysis

Understanding the 96.12% RTP

Rise of Maya features an RTP (Return to Player) of 96.12%, which positions it competitively within the online slot market. RTP represents the theoretical percentage of wagered money that a slot machine returns to players over an extended period. With an RTP of 96.12%, Rise of Maya returns approximately £96.12 for every £100 wagered over the long term, with the remaining £3.88 representing the house edge.

For UK players, it's important to understand that RTP is calculated over millions of spins and represents a long-term average. Individual sessions can vary significantly from this figure, with some sessions resulting in substantial wins and others in losses. The 96.12% RTP is considered above average for online slots, where RTPs typically range from 94% to 98%.

NetEnt Profile

Company History and Reputation

NetEnt (Net Entertainment) is one of the most respected and influential software providers in the online gaming industry. Founded in Sweden in 1996, the company has grown to become a global leader in premium gaming solutions, known for pushing the boundaries of what's possible in online slot design. NetEnt's commitment to quality, innovation, and fair play has earned them numerous industry awards and a loyal following among players worldwide.

The company went public on the Stockholm Stock Exchange in 2007 and has since expanded its operations globally, with offices across Europe and North America. In 2020, NetEnt merged with Evolution Gaming to create one of the largest B2B gaming suppliers in the world, combining NetEnt's slot expertise with Evolution's live casino prowess.

Recognising Problem Gambling

Problem gambling can develop gradually, making early recognition important. Warning signs include spending more time or money on gambling than intended, neglecting responsibilities or relationships due to gambling, feeling restless or irritable when trying to stop, and gambling to escape problems or relieve negative emotions.

If you recognise any of these signs in yourself or someone you know, it's important to seek help promptly. The UK offers numerous resources for problem gambling support, including the National Gambling Helpline (0808 8020 133) and organisations such as GamCare and Gamblers Anonymous.

Tools and Resources

UK-licensed casinos are required to offer various responsible gambling tools that players should utilise:

  • Deposit Limits: Set daily, weekly, or monthly caps on how much you can deposit
  • Loss Limits: Establish maximum amounts you're willing to lose in set periods
  • Session Limits: Set time reminders or automatic session endings
  • Reality Checks: Receive periodic notifications showing time spent playing
  • Self-Exclusion: Temporarily or permanently block yourself from gambling
  • GAMSTOP: The UK's national self-exclusion scheme covering all licensed operators
